RTPWhat does RTP mean? โ
RTP stands for return to player, a theoretical figure used in a gameโs math model over a very large number of plays. It does not tell you what will happen in one short session. Use it as a reference point, not a promise.
For the exact figure, check the game information shown on the site. If a value is not listed, do not guess.

SecurityShould I share my password or PIN with anyone? โ
No. Passwords and PINs should stay private, even if a message sounds official. Support should not need your full login secret to answer a basic question. If someone asks for it, pause and verify the request through the official contact page.
That small pause protects the account better than trying to be helpful in the moment.
SecurityWhat should I do if I see a suspicious message asking for details? โ
Do not reply with account information, payment details, or codes. Save the message, check whether it came from an approved contact path, and report it through support. The safest move is to treat unexpected requests as unverified until the platform confirms them.
If the message mentions payment or login, compare it with the page you were actually using before you answer.
DeviceHow can I keep my account safer on shared devices? โ
Log out after use, avoid saving passwords on public phones or borrowed laptops, and clear the browser session if needed. Shared devices are convenient, but they also leave a trail. A few extra taps now can prevent a mess later.
If you must switch devices often, make session cleanup part of the routine.

BudgetHow can I keep spending within a budget? โ
Set a fixed amount before you play and treat it as entertainment spending, not income. Once the limit is reached, stop there. Small habits help: use a timer, avoid topping up on impulse, and review the budget before the session starts.
If the number feels uncomfortable, make the limit smaller. The plan should fit the player, not the other way around.
MindsetWhy should I avoid chasing losses? โ
Because trying to win back losses usually pushes the budget further out of shape. A short break makes more sense than forcing another round. If the session stops feeling calm, step away and return only when you are comfortable.
That reset is often the better move for both your budget and your mood.
BreaksWhen should I take a break? โ
Take a break when the session feels rushed, stressful, or less fun than expected. If you are checking the screen too often or making decisions too fast, that is a good sign to stop. A short pause resets the pace.
